Romanian language courses for foreigners to begin in Bucharest and at Romanian Cultural Institute representations abroad

Image

The Romanian Cultural Institute (ICR) on Monday launched a new edition of its Romanian language courses for foreigners, to be held in Bucharest throughout 2026.

According to a press release from the ICR Press Office sent to AGERPRES, the courses organised in the capital will begin at the same time as the 2026 sessions of Romanian language courses run by ICR Tel Aviv and by the ICR representation in Poland, both in Warsaw and Lodz, in a lectureship format, in cooperation with the Institute of Romance Languages within the university's Faculty of Philology.

ICR representations in Brussels, Lisbon, Paris, Prague, Tokyo and Berlin will also launch new sessions of Romanian language courses in the coming period.

In Bucharest, this year's course structure includes three sessions: the first will run from February to April, the second from April to July, and the third from September to November.

Registration for each session takes place prior to the start of the courses, during dedicated enrolment periods. The participation fee for each course module, regardless of the chosen format, is RON 1,000.

Detailed information on how to enrol in the Romanian language courses for foreigners organised by ICR in Bucharest is available on www.icr.ro, in the COURSES section.

Launched in 2008, the programme 'ROMAN(I)A PE SCURT (ROMANIA(N) IN A NUTSHELL) - Romanian Language Courses for Foreigners' is one of the ICR's permanent projects, having seen steady development over time in terms of content quality, diversity and teaching methods.

The ICR currently organises more than 50 course sessions each year in Bucharest and across 18 representations abroad, both for foreigners and for children from Romanian communities. It also organises annually the Brasov Summer School - Romanian Language, Culture and Civilisation Courses. AGERPRES (RO - writing by: Daniel Popescu; EN - writing by: Simona Iacob)
